Fermium Production

Production

Fermium is obtained on cyclotron bombardment of Thorium, Uranium or Plutonium by accelerated ions of Nitrogen, Helium or Carbon, respectively as well as by neutron irradiation of Plutonium, Curium or Californium in reactors. 257Fm is produced in largest quantities, around 109 atoms annually. In optimal conditions several µgs of 257Fm may be synthesized from 1gramm of 252Cf.

The first Fermium had been produced by simultaneous neutron trapping by Uranium with consequent β--decay.

238U92 + 17n -> 255U92 --(8β-)--> 255Fm100
